3大核心优势如何让LocalAI成为企业本地化AI部署首选
在数字化转型加速的今天,企业对AI能力的需求与日俱增,但数据隐私、网络延迟和成本控制等问题成为制约AI落地的关键瓶颈。LocalAI作为开源本地化AI推理平台,通过创新架构设计和灵活部署方案,为企业提供了安全可控、高性能且经济高效的AI解决方案。本文将从核心价值、技术内幕和实战应用三个维度,解析LocalAI如何解决企业AI部署痛点,以及如何在不同业务场景中实现价值最大化。
核心价值解析:企业级本地化AI的三大突破
实现数据零出境的隐私保护机制
在金融、医疗等数据敏感行业,AI模型处理过程中的数据安全始终是首要考量。LocalAI通过将所有推理计算过程限制在企业内部环境,从根本上解决了数据跨境流动带来的合规风险。与传统云AI服务相比,LocalAI构建了"数据不出本地"的安全屏障,使企业能够在完全符合GDPR、HIPAA等监管要求的前提下,充分利用AI技术提升业务效率。
构建弹性扩展的混合部署架构
LocalAI创新性地采用模块化设计,支持从边缘设备到企业服务器的全场景部署。无论是需要低延迟响应的工业现场设备,还是对计算能力要求极高的数据分析中心,LocalAI都能通过灵活的配置策略实现资源最优分配。这种弹性架构使企业可以根据业务需求动态调整AI基础设施,避免过度投资或资源浪费。
打造开放兼容的AI能力生态
作为开源项目,LocalAI打破了厂商锁定,支持市场上主流的AI模型格式和推理框架。企业无需重构现有系统即可无缝集成LocalAI,保护已有技术投资。同时,活跃的社区生态持续为LocalAI注入新的模型支持和功能优化,使企业能够紧跟AI技术发展前沿,快速应用最新算法成果。
深度技术内幕:高性能本地化推理的实现之道
分层解耦的架构设计
LocalAI采用清晰的分层架构,通过gRPC协议实现前后端解耦,为高性能推理奠定基础:
// 核心接口定义示例
type LLMBackend interface {
Generate(context.Context, *GenerationRequest) (*GenerationResponse, error)
Embed(context.Context, *EmbeddingRequest) (*EmbeddingResponse, error)
}
这一设计使API网关层、后端服务层和模型管理层能够独立演进,既保证了系统稳定性,又为功能扩展提供了灵活性。API网关层处理客户端请求并进行负载均衡,后端服务层负责高效执行模型推理,模型管理层则优化资源分配和缓存策略,三者协同工作实现高性能推理。
图1:LocalAI分层架构示意图,展示了API网关、后端服务和模型管理的协同工作流程,体现了本地化AI部署的技术架构优势
硬件感知的智能优化引擎
LocalAI内置的硬件优化引擎能够自动识别运行环境的硬件特性,并应用针对性的优化策略:
- CPU优化:通过多线程调度和内存管理优化,充分利用多核处理器性能
- GPU加速:支持NVIDIA CUDA和AMD ROCm等异构计算平台,实现大规模并行计算
- 低功耗模式:针对边缘设备优化的低功耗配置,延长移动设备续航时间
这种硬件感知能力使LocalAI能够在各种硬件环境下都保持最佳性能表现,从资源受限的嵌入式设备到高性能服务器集群均能高效运行。
动态模型管理系统
LocalAI的动态模型管理系统解决了企业AI部署中的资源分配难题。系统能够根据模型大小、推理需求和硬件资源状况,智能调整模型加载策略:
- 按需加载:仅在需要时加载模型到内存,减少资源占用
- 优先级调度:根据请求重要性动态调整模型资源分配
- 缓存优化:智能缓存高频访问的模型和推理结果,降低重复计算
这一系统使企业能够在有限的硬件资源下运行多个AI模型,实现资源利用最大化。
实战应用指南:从部署到优化的全流程方案
快速部署企业私有AI服务
LocalAI提供多种部署选项,满足不同企业的IT环境需求:
容器化部署(推荐):
git clone https://gitcode.com/gh_mirrors/loc/LocalAI
cd LocalAI
docker-compose up -d
原生部署:
git clone https://gitcode.com/gh_mirrors/loc/LocalAI
cd LocalAI
make build
./localai --models-path ./models
两种部署方式均支持自定义配置,企业可根据自身IT策略选择最适合的部署方案。部署完成后,LocalAI提供与OpenAI兼容的API接口,现有应用可无缝迁移。
常见业务场景适配指南
| 业务场景 | 推荐模型配置 | 关键优化参数 | 典型应用案例 |
|---|---|---|---|
| 客户服务聊天机器人 | llama-3-8b-instruct | temperature=0.7, max_tokens=1024 | 24/7智能客服系统 |
| 文档智能分析 | bert-embeddings + rerankers | batch_size=32, context_size=2048 | 合同自动审查系统 |
| 语音助手 | whisper-base + piper | language=en, response_format=json | 企业内部语音指令系统 |
| 图像生成与分析 | stablediffusion + llava | steps=20, guidance_scale=7.5 | 产品设计辅助工具 |
性能优化决策树
当面对性能挑战时,可按照以下决策路径进行优化:
-
推理延迟过高
- 检查是否启用硬件加速
- 降低模型精度(如从fp16转为int8)
- 增加批处理大小
- 考虑使用更小的模型
-
内存占用过大
- 启用低内存模式(low_vram: true)
- 采用模型分片技术
- 优化缓存策略
- 升级硬件内存
-
吞吐量不足
- 增加并发处理线程
- 优化请求队列管理
- 部署负载均衡集群
- 实施请求优先级机制
图2:基于LocalAI构建的企业聊天机器人界面,展示了本地化AI在客户服务场景中的应用效果
企业落地价值与未来展望
LocalAI通过技术创新解决了企业AI部署中的核心痛点,其价值不仅体现在技术层面,更转化为实际的业务收益:降低云服务成本、提升数据安全性、增强系统响应速度、保障业务连续性。随着大模型技术的快速发展,LocalAI将继续优化多模型协同推理、增量模型更新等关键能力,为企业提供更加灵活高效的本地化AI解决方案。
对于寻求AI转型的企业而言,LocalAI提供了一条低风险、高回报的实施路径。无论是小型团队的原型验证,还是大型企业的规模化部署,LocalAI都能通过其模块化设计和灵活配置满足不同阶段的需求,成为企业数字化转型的强大助力。
atomcodeClaude Code 的开源替代方案。连接任意大模型,编辑代码,运行命令,自动验证 — 全自动执行。用 Rust 构建,极致性能。 | An open-source alternative to Claude Code. Connect any LLM, edit code, run commands, and verify changes — autonomously. Built in Rust for speed. Get StartedRust0138- DDeepSeek-V4-ProDeepSeek-V4-Pro(总参数 1.6 万亿,激活 49B)面向复杂推理和高级编程任务,在代码竞赛、数学推理、Agent 工作流等场景表现优异,性能接近国际前沿闭源模型。Python00
GLM-5.1GLM-5.1是智谱迄今最智能的旗舰模型,也是目前全球最强的开源模型。GLM-5.1大大提高了代码能力,在完成长程任务方面提升尤为显著。和此前分钟级交互的模型不同,它能够在一次任务中独立、持续工作超过8小时,期间自主规划、执行、自我进化,最终交付完整的工程级成果。Jinja00
MiniCPM-V-4.6这是 MiniCPM-V 系列有史以来效率与性能平衡最佳的模型。它以仅 1.3B 的参数规模,实现了性能与效率的双重突破,在全球同尺寸模型中登顶,全面超越了阿里 Qwen3.5-0.8B 与谷歌 Gemma4-E2B-it。Jinja00
MiniMax-M2.7MiniMax-M2.7 是我们首个深度参与自身进化过程的模型。M2.7 具备构建复杂智能体应用框架的能力,能够借助智能体团队、复杂技能以及动态工具搜索,完成高度精细的生产力任务。Python00
MusicFreeDesktop插件化、定制化、无广告的免费音乐播放器TypeScript00